More Permian-Focused Money Flowing as Charger Gets Oaktree Commitment

Charger Shale Oil Co. LLC, formed only a few months ago, has secured up to $900 million from joint venture partner Oaktree Capital Management LP to expand its Permian Basin footprint in West Texas.

Most North American Basin Pricing Still ‘Unsustainable,’ Says Schlumberger Exec

The global oil supply is tightening, and markets should move closer to balance by the end of this year, but it’s too early for “any improvement in price” to affect exploration investments because operator confidence and balance sheets still need to be repaired, Schlumberger Ltd.’s operations chief said Tuesday.

Latest Mexico Bidding Round Offering Burgos Basin NatGas Acreage

Mexico’s Energy Secretary on Tuesday approved the bidding process for a dozen onshore exploration and production areas open to international investment. The acreage contains mostly natural gas and includes nine blocks in the Burgos Basin south of the Texas border.

Global Reserves Shortfall Forecast If Producers Eschew Exploration Investments

Global Reserves Shortfall Forecast If Producers Eschew Exploration Investments

The global oil market faces a supply shortfall of 4.5 million b/d by 2035 if exploration success — and investments — aren’t stepped up, Wood Mackenzie researchers are forecasting.

Hess to Cut 2016 E&P Spending by 40%

Hess Corp. plans to spend $2.4 billion on exploration and production (E&P) in 2016, a 40% year/year cut and a 20% drop from the preliminary 2016 guidance of $2.9-3.1 billion the company provided in October.

Gastar Touts Meramec Test, Expands STACK/Hunton Limestone Exposure

Gastar Exploration Inc.’s first operated test in the Meramec formation within Oklahoma’s stacked reservoirs appears to extend the definition of one of the most promising plays in the U.S. onshore.

Shell Scrambles to Hold Offshore Alaska Leases Beyond Expiration Date

Royal Dutch Shell plc has suspended indefinitely its exploration projects offshore Alaska, but it is continuing to fight for the right to drill prospects in the future.

Statoil, Partners Capture Frontier Leases Offshore Newfoundland, Nova Scotia

Statoil ASA and its partners ExxonMobil Corp., Chevron Corp., BP plc and BG plc have claimed six frontier exploration licenses in the Flemish Pass Basin offshore Newfoundland, as well as two licenses to explore for oil and natural gas offshore Nova Scotia.

Court Thwarts Alaska Bid to Explore ANWR Coastal Plain

Alaska may not conduct 3-D seismic exploration and drilling in the 1.5-million coastal plain of the Arctic National Wildlife Refuge (ANWR), according to a U.S. District Court ruling issued in Alaska Tuesday. It is the latest blow to the state’s long-running effort to assess the area’s resource potential.
